What YOU bring to the role:
  • Registered Medical Laboratory Technologist OR: 
  • A member of the College of Physicians and Surgeons of British Columbia who has at least one year of post-graduate experience in a laboratory or laboratories, working in a relevant laboratory specialty.
  • Has obtained from a university an academic doctorate degree in a relevant area of chemical, physical or biological science and has at least one year of post-graduate experience in a laboratory.
  • Has obtained from a university a masters degree in a relevant area of chemical, physical or biological science and has at least two years of relevant post-graduate training or experience in a laboratory.
  • Has obtained from a university a bachelors degree in a relevant area of chemical, physical or biological science and has at least four years of relevant post-graduate training or experience in a laboratory. 
  • 7 to 10 years of previous managerial experience and demonstrated increased responsibility in a clinical environment demonstrating readiness for a management role
